From d4c136c525d91daff5351ec7201b474b8d9ed123 Mon Sep 17 00:00:00 2001 From: tildearrow Date: Sun, 2 Jul 2023 02:13:50 -0500 Subject: [PATCH] renderDX11: don't error on DXGI_STATUS_OCCLUDED --- src/gui/render/renderDX11.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/gui/render/renderDX11.cpp b/src/gui/render/renderDX11.cpp index 04d8dfb87..d3bd13069 100644 --- a/src/gui/render/renderDX11.cpp +++ b/src/gui/render/renderDX11.cpp @@ -349,7 +349,7 @@ void FurnaceGUIRenderDX11::present() { HRESULT result=swapchain->Present(1,0); if (result==DXGI_ERROR_DEVICE_REMOVED || result==DXGI_ERROR_DEVICE_RESET) { dead=true; - } else if (result!=S_OK) { + } else if (result!=S_OK && result!=DXGI_STATUS_OCCLUDED) { logE("DX11: present failed! %.8x",result); } }